A dynasty who ruled the Gwalior Fort and its surrounding region in central India during the 14th-16th centuries.
Establishment
- January 1401: The Tomaras were a dynasty who ruled the Gwalior Fort and its surrounding region in central India during 14th-16th centuries. In the 1390s, they gained control of Gwalior, and became independent in the subsequent years.

Disestablishment
- January 1526: The Tomaras were displaced from Gwalior by Ibrahim Lodi in the first quarter of the 16th century.
